British Girl Dies After Drowning in Lanzarote Hotel Pool

A four‑year‑old British girl died on Saturday after being rescued from a hotel pool in Playa Blanca, Lanzarote. Emergency services were alerted at 13:30 by the hotel staff. A nurse coordinating the 112 call confirmed the child was in cardiac arrest and guided a lifeguard through basic CPR. Advanced life‑support teams, including two ambulances and a medical helicopter, arrived and continued resuscitation, but the girl could not be revived.

The local Consorcio de Seguridad, Emergencias, Salvamento, Prevención y Extinción de Incendios and police secured the area to allow the helicopter to land and take off safely. The Guardia Civil opened an investigation to determine the circumstances of the incident. The tragedy follows two other drownings reported in Spain on the same day.
